  • How to be ready to succeed in sports
    Author Taylor Marr presents one of the best guides for those who are entering various forms of athletic participation in this now indispensible cogent ‘training book.’ Or as the author states, ‘Whether you’re a beginner or an experienced athlete, there are some common things that you should know to ensure that your athletic journey is safe, meaningful, and fun.’

    Accompanied with some excellent artwork that illuminates the text, Marr discusses everything from the importance of setting realistic goals to physical and mental preparation to the correct approach to physical training, understanding (and incorporating!) good sportsmanship, the importance of teamwork, physical care from nutrition and hydration to injury prevention – the advice is encompassing. Marr’s writing style is straightforward and completely accessible, making this fine book a ‘must read’ for aspiring (and experienced!) athletes. Recommended.
